Output 83b67578cf53d6131f3e834874d96d51ecd490f58bd4a570a288c234ae19965c:1

value
40264253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666d1dbef9fcae41e7c244102d47fdc7de0b7f6a OP_EQUAL
address
MHEjsXHov7SxisqwhP9KueVbj8gL1QxcpC
transaction
83b67578cf53d6131f3e834874d96d51ecd490f58bd4a570a288c234ae19965c
spent
true